Osborn Health And Rehabilitation Costs & Pricing

Osborn Health and Rehabilitation offers competitive pricing for its care services compared to the surrounding region, providing an attractive option for those seeking rehabilitation support in Maricopa County. The monthly cost for a studio room is $2,300, significantly lower than the county average of $3,960 and the state average of $3,829. For a one-bedroom unit, residents will pay $3,000, which also undercuts both the county's average of $3,473 and Arizona's statewide figure of $3,532. Additionally, their two-bedroom accommodations are priced at $4,000 - slightly higher than the county's average of $4,112 but comparable to the state's average of $4,106. This pricing structure highlights Osborn Health and Rehabilitation as an appealing choice for families looking for quality care that won't break the bank.

Overall Review of Osborn Health And Rehabilitation

caveat 22 reviews mention this

Call lights and care response vary

Many residents and families report slow or missed help when call buttons are used.

A recurring concern is response delays for help, including unanswered call lights and situations where residents report waiting a long time for assistance. Several reviewers describe medication issues, missed meal delivery, or staff not arriving promptly even when help was requested. Some comments also describe patients left in soiled conditions while waiting for care. On the other hand, other reviews praise attentive nursing and faster room-call or medication support, suggesting experiences vary by shift and situation.

caveat 18 reviews mention this

Food quality gets mixed reviews

Meal quality is a frequent complaint, with multiple reports of unappetizing food.

Several reviews criticize meals, describing them as inedible, poor quality, or not matching what residents need for healing. Others mention specific problems like cold food, limited options, or delays in getting meals and drinks. A smaller number of reviewers say food was acceptable or even tasty, but those comments don’t outweigh the negative feedback. Overall, dining appears to be one of the more inconsistent day-to-day experiences described by families.

caveat 14 reviews mention this

Cleanliness concerns come up often

Residents and families mention recurring cleanliness issues, including pests and odors.

Some reviewers report unpleasant conditions such as foul smells, dirty rooms, or reports of pests like cockroaches. Others describe issues that suggest hygiene and housekeeping lapses, including concerns about soiled items and inadequate cleaning. While there are also reviews that highlight cleanliness and cite cleaning crews or a well-maintained environment, the negative cleanliness stories appear repeatedly enough to be a notable caution. If you prioritize day-to-day cleanliness, these comments are worth taking seriously.

common 20 reviews mention this

Therapy support is often praised

Physical and occupational therapy are repeatedly mentioned as a positive part of stays.

Many reviews focus on rehabilitation therapy, describing therapists as kind, patient, and helpful with mobility and recovery goals. Several families and patients credit PT/OT with making progress and safely improving strength or walking ability. Even when other aspects of the stay drew criticism, multiple reviewers still singled out therapy teams for doing good work. The care experience described in reviews suggests that rehab services are a consistent strength.

caveat 16 reviews mention this

Staffing levels are a key concern

Multiple reviews describe understaffing that can affect timely personal care.

A number of reviews point to staffing shortages, describing long waits for help with bathroom needs, showers, or basic daily assistance. Some comments describe being left unattended for extended periods, along with difficulty getting medications or supplies in time. A few reviewers contrast that by praising staff availability and saying response times improved or felt well covered. Still, the staffing-related complaints are prominent enough to stand out as a risk factor for families considering the facility.
